i have 6400 and MCE xp and am running the latest version of msn no problems
if you have connection problems, try windows zero configuration wireless (windows wifi managine software). i find that windows does a pretty good job of that and is better then the intel stuff.
all you need to do is right click the intel icon at the bottom right and click "use window zero configurtaion wireless" -
